Applicant's summary and conclusion

Conclusions:
The surface tension of a 1 % aqueous solution of the substance is 66.4 mN/m at 20 °C.
Executive summary:

The surface tension of an aqueous solution containing the substance in a concentration of approx. 1 g/L is determined to be 66.4 mN/m at 20 °C. The substance has therefore no surface-active properties.
